The flat price action for GRNQ reflects muted trading interest, with volume likely below recent averages as the stock shows little volatility. As a micro‑cap name, GRNQ often experiences wider price swings on lower liquidity, but today’s session exhibited no such movement. The unchanged close at $1.41 places the stock near the midpoint of its established trading range ($1.34–$1.48), indicating that neither buyers nor sellers have asserted control. Sector positioning offers limited context—Greenpro Capital operates in business services and investment management, areas that have seen mixed performance amid shifting economic expectations. The lack of price change may reflect market indecision ahead of company‑specific announcements or broader macroeconomic data. Without a clear catalyst, the stock is likely to remain range‑bound until volume picks up or price breaks through one of the noted boundaries. Traders should watch for any surge in participation that could signal the start of a more definitive move.

Support at $1.34 has held on recent pullbacks, while resistance near $1.48 has capped upside attempts. The current price of $1.41 sits close to the channel’s midline, offering little immediate directional bias. The stock’s relative strength index (RSI) likely sits in a neutral range (around 45‑55), confirming the absence of strong momentum. Short‑term moving averages may be flattening or converging around the $1.40 area, further underscoring the consolidation phase. Volume patterns have been inconsistent, with no clear breakout or breakdown volumes in recent sessions. A sustained move above $1.48 would signal renewed buying interest and could target the next resistance zone, while a breakdown below $1.34 would likely lead to a test of lower support levels. Until a clear pattern emerges, the price action remains choppy and non‑directional.

Looking ahead, GRNQ could see a breakout from its current range if a catalyst emerges—such as a corporate update, earnings release, or sector‑wide shift. A move above $1.48 with strong volume might propel the stock toward the $1.55–$1.60 area. Conversely, if selling pressure increases and support at $1.34 fails, the stock could slide to the next support near $1.25 or lower. Factors that could influence future performance include changes in the company’s business outlook, broader market sentiment toward small‑caps, and macroeconomic conditions affecting capital markets. Given the stock’s low liquidity, any news may produce outsized moves. Investors should monitor volume closely for confirmation of any trend change. The current sideways trading may persist as traders await a clearer directional signal. Patience is warranted until the stock demonstrates a decisive break from its established boundaries.
